Lemon Cream Pie Recipe

Ingredients with Measurements:
- 1 9-inch pie crust
- 1 cup heavy cream
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 1/2 cup fresh lemon juice
- 1 tablespoon lemon zest
- 4 large egg yolks
- 1/4 cup cornstarch
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 cup unsalted butter, cut into small pieces

Special Equipment Needed:
- 9-inch pie dish
- Mixing bowls
- Whisk
- Saucepan
- Wooden spoon
- Plastic wrap

Step-by-Step Instructions:

1. Preheat the oven to 375°F.

2. Bake the pie crust according to the package instructions and let it cool completely.

3. In a medium saucepan, whisk together the sugar, cornstarch, and salt.

4. Add the egg yolks, lemon juice, and lemon zest to the saucepan and whisk until smooth.

5. Gradually whisk in the heavy cream until well combined.

6. Place the saucepan over medium heat and cook, stirring constantly with a wooden spoon, until the mixture thickens and comes to a boil.

7. Remove the saucepan from the heat and stir in the butter until melted and smooth.

8. Pour the lemon cream filling into the cooled pie crust and smooth the top with a spatula.

9. Cover the pie with pl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 2 hours or until set.

10. Serve chilled.

Substitutions for ingredients:
- Heavy cream can be substituted with half-and-half or whole milk.
- Cornstarch can be substituted with all-purpose flour or arrowroot powder.
- Unsalted butter can be substituted with salted butter or margarine.

Variations:
- Add a meringue topping and brown it under the broiler for a classic lemon meringue pie.
- Use graham cracker crust instead of a regular pie crust for a different texture.
- Add a layer of fresh berries on top of the lemon cream filling for a fruity twist.

Tips and Tricks:
- Use fresh lemon juice and zest for the best flavor.
- Make sure to constantly stir the lemon cream filling while cooking to prevent lumps.
- Let the pie cool completely before refrigerating to prevent condensation on the plastic wrap.
